Rojadirecta has long been the "Wild West" of sports streaming. It doesn't host content itself but acts as a directory for links to other streams. While it has survived numerous legal battles for over a decade, its "free" price tag comes with significant hidden costs: Security Risks:

The counter-argument, often voiced on fan forums, is that Rojadirecta also grows the sport. A 14-year-old in Indonesia who cannot afford a subscription watches Márquez win on a stream. That child buys a replica helmet two years later. The piracy becomes a gateway drug.
